What is Kix Digital Downloads? Overview and Purpose
Kix Digital Downloads is a specialized Shopify app designed to help merchants sell and deliver digital files seamlessly. Its primary purpose is to automate the distribution of products like eBooks, digital art, and software, eliminating the need for manual fulfillment. The app integrates directly into your Shopify storefront, allowing you to offer these products without changing your existing checkout process. By handling the technical heavy lifting, it ensures your customers receive their purchases instantly while you focus on marketing and growing your business.
Core Capabilities
- Instant Delivery: Automatically emails download links or license keys immediately after purchase.
- Product Variety: Supports a wide range of formats, including audio files, videos, PDFs, and software license keys.
- Shopify Integration: Works as a native add-on, appearing alongside physical products in your catalog.

Secure File Delivery and PDF Stamping
Security is paramount when selling digital goods to prevent piracy and unauthorized sharing. Kix offers robust security measures to protect your intellectual property. One of its most notable features is PDF stamping, which allows you to embed the buyer's information (name, date, order ID) directly into the PDF file. This ensures that if a file is shared, the recipient can be identified. Additionally, the app provides download limits and IP restrictions, giving you control over how and when customers can access your files.
License Keys and QR Code Access
For merchants selling software or games, Kix provides a mechanism to deliver unique license keys automatically. The app can generate promo codes and vouchers that are instantly sent to the customer's email. For even more advanced security, the QR code-based access feature allows you to create unique, scannable codes that customers must use to unlock their specific digital product, adding an extra layer of protection against bulk downloading.
Custom Branding and Analytics
A great user experience contributes to customer retention. Kix Digital Downloads allows you to customize the look and feel of your download pages and confirmation emails. You can add your logo and branding elements to make the digital handoff feel professional. Furthermore, the built-in analytics dashboard lets you track sales of digital products, monitor popular downloads, and review license usage, helping you make data-driven decisions about your inventory.

Performance and Reliability
Kix Digital Downloads is powered by Amazon S3 for file hosting, which ensures high uptime and fast file delivery speeds globally. This is critical for digital products, as slow download speeds can lead to negative reviews and abandoned carts. The app performs reliably during peak sales events, ensuring that your digital inventory is not a bottleneck. Reliability is key for digital products, and Kix holds up well under pressure, minimizing the risk of broken links or delivery errors.
Pricing and Value for Money
Kix Digital Downloads operates on a monthly subscription model with overage fees for exceeding order limits. This structure can be tricky for businesses experiencing rapid growth.
- Free Plan: $0/month for 50 orders, 5GB storage, and up to 100MB per file.
- Pro Plan: $7.99/month for 200 orders, 15GB storage, and 500MB per file.
- Plus Plan: $12.99/month for 500 orders, 30GB storage, and 1GB per file.
- Unlimited Plan: $24.99/month for 5000 orders and unlimited storage.
While the entry price is low, the per-order fee ($0.10) on lower tiers can make the app expensive if you hit unexpected traffic spikes. The Unlimited Plan offers the best value for established brands with high volume, eliminating the stress of order limits altogether.
